Gate repair in Santa Monica is a different job than it is ten miles inland. The salt-laden marine layer that rolls off the Pacific keeps metal damp for months at a stretch, and that changes what fails, when it fails, and how it needs to be fixed. A swing gate that would run quietly for a decade in Sherman Oaks can develop rust through the hinge welds in three years here, simply because the air itself is corrosive. Electric Gate Repair

Electric gates in Santa Monica fail in predictable ways, and most of them trace back to corrosion. The control board, the wiring terminals, the keypad connections, and the photo-eye lenses all sit exposed to salt air, and they degrade faster than the manufacturer’s warranty timeline assumes. We troubleshoot the entire system, from the motor to the safety sensors, and we specify sealed enclosures where the location demands it. A control board two blocks from Ocean Avenue should not be mounted in the same open enclosure you’d use in Encino.

Automatic Gate Repair

Santa Monica gate motor and opener units along the coast face a double load: salt corrosion on the electronics and constant mechanical strain on the motor if the gate has settled or started to bind. We repair operators from LiftMaster, FAAC, BFT, and Linear, and we don’t steer you toward replacement when the existing motor can be repaired. The failure is often something specific, a corroded loop detector terminal, a limit switch set past travel, a capacitor that’s gone weak, and the fix is documented in the written record you receive before the job closes.

Hinge & Post Repair

Hinges and posts are where salt air does its most visible damage in Santa Monica. Wrought-iron estate gates north of Montana, Spanish Colonial bungalow gates in Sunset Park, and mid-century apartment building gates near Ocean Park all share the same issue: the metal at the post base and hinge welds rusts from constant damp exposure, often from the inside out. We cut out the failed section, weld in new steel, and use stainless fixings where the original hardware was mild steel. The repair is invisible when we’re done, but the material difference is what makes it last.

Gate Realignment

When a gate starts dragging on the driveway or struggling to close, the panel often looks straight but the posts have moved. In Santa Monica, that movement frequently comes from old fence posts that weren’t engineered for the added weight of a motorized gate, especially on 1920s and 1930s houses where the original posts are wood or unreinforced masonry. We reset the post, shim the hinge line, and adjust the operator’s travel limits so the motor stops fighting the sag. Then we photograph the new position and record the limit-switch settings so the next service call starts from a known baseline.

Common Gate Repair Problems We See in Santa Monica Homes

Professional welder performing metal gate repair and hinge installation
Common Gate Repair Problems We See in Santa Monica Homes
  • Salt corrosion on hinge posts and weld joints. The marine layer keeps steel damp through the summer, and painted mild steel gives out years earlier than it would in West LA. We see hinge barrels cracked from internal rust and post bases thinned to the point of leaning.
  • Operator control board failure within blocks of the beach. Gate motor control boards within two to three blocks of Ocean Avenue often fail within two to four years from salt intrusion, a failure mode almost never mentioned in warranty literature but routinely seen by Santa Monica technicians. The fix is a sealed NEMA 4X enclosure, not another open board.
  • Photo-eye lens fogging with salt film. The safety photocell, the infrared beam that stops the gate if something crosses the path, gets a fine salt crust on the lens in coastal air. The gate starts reversing for no obvious reason, and the homeowner assumes the motor is failing. Often it’s a ten-minute lens cleaning and a seal check, but the cause is distinctly coastal.
  • Sagging gates on aging posts. Homes in Ocean Park and Sunset Park frequently have motorized gates hung on posts that date from the original construction, 1920s wood or stucco over brick, and the added operator load plus rust at the base causes the gate to drag. The panel itself is usually straight; the post is the problem.

Pricing for Gate Repair in Santa Monica, CA

Gate repair in Santa Monica runs within predictable ranges, and we put the number in writing before any work starts. A hinge and post repair, including cutting out the rusted section and welding in new steel, typically runs $350 to $700 depending on how much material has to be replaced and whether the gate needs realignment after. Operator control board replacement, including a sealed NEMA 4X enclosure where the location requires it, usually runs $450 to $950 depending on the brand and board version. Photo-eye realignment or replacement is $150 to $300. Weld and rust repair on a wrought-iron gate runs $200 to $600 per affected area, with stainless fixings included.
